We are seeking a proactive, organised and results-driven Events Executive to support the planning, coordination and delivery of a diverse portfolio of events that drive brand awareness and promote membership opportunities. As part of a growing team at one of the UK’s largest trade associations, you will work closely with the Head of Events & Marketing to deliver strategic initiatives that elevate the UKWA brand across the warehousing, logistics and associated sectors. This is a hands-on role suited to a creative and commercially minded individual looking to build their career in events and marketing within a fast-paced membership environment.
You will play a key role in the rollout of integrated events and marketing campaigns that enhance the association’s visibility, strengthen member engagement, and deliver high-quality event experiences aligned with UKWA’s strategic objectives. This is a full-time hybrid role, Monday to Friday. Typically, you will spend 2–3 days per week in our friendly Market Harborough office, though this may vary depending on business needs and event schedules. Occasional UK travel and overnight stays are an exciting and essential part of the role.
Role and Responsibilities
- Events Coordination
- Contribute to the design and delivery of UKWA’s events strategy, aligned with organisational goals and priorities.
- Support the successful delivery of events across the UKWA portfolio, including the National Conference and the Awards for Excellence Annual Lunch, welcoming over 500 industry representatives.
- Manage UKWA’s presence at third-party trade shows and events, ensuring strong sponsorship visibility, effective planning and seamless on-site coordination.
- Evaluate and report on event performance, using attendee, stakeholder and team feedback alongside key metrics to drive continuous improvement and enhance member experience.
- Marketing Coordination
- Identify opportunities to grow awareness of UKWA’s initiatives, events and membership benefits.
- Support event registration and attendance through targeted campaigns and outreach.
- Lead the creation of impactful event collateral and marketing materials.
- Stakeholder Engagement
- Professionally represent the association, its members and the wider warehousing and logistics industry to a range of stakeholders.
- Attend key industry events and act as a confident brand ambassador for UKWA.
- Support cross-functional projects and proactively contribute to UKWA’s broader success.
- Bring fresh ideas and suggest process improvements to enhance team performance.
Essential Skills and Experience
- We’re looking for a highly motivated self-starter who is eager to learn, degree-qualified (or equivalent), with a minimum of two years’ experience in a similar events or marketing role.
- The ideal candidate will have:
- Proven 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ously, with strong attention to detail and deadlines.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with confidence presenting to internal and external stakeholders.
- Strong relationship-building skills, with experience working with event vendors, external partners, media outlets, marketing teams and industry influencers.
- Willingness to travel and work flexible hours in line with event schedules.

About UKWA
The UK Warehousing Association (UKWA) is the dedicated trade association for the UK’s vital warehousing sector. We represent over 1,000 member companies operating around 200 million square feet of warehousing and distribution space across thousands of locations. UKWA members benefit from a wide range of valuable services, from professional business advice and strategic support to networking opportunities and exclusive offers from specialist partners and associates.
